## Deploying the Gatewick Proctor Queue

Deploys are pretty painless: push to main, wait for the pipeline, then watch the queue drain dashboard for five minutes. If candidates pile up mid-exam, roll back first and ask questions later — the queue replays safely. Everything the workers care about lives in one config block, shown here for reference.

settings of bafof-yagef:
JOROX_PIN=8740
JOROX_TENANT=pelox
JOROX_METRICS_HOST=metrics.jorox.qorvelworks.internal
JOROX_SEAL=seal_c78f63c1
JOROX_STANDBY_TEAM=norax

// Heads up, on-call: this constant pins the Marrowgate report exporter to UTC.
// Don't be tempted to switch it to server-local time — we tried that once and
// customers in three regions got reports with shifted day boundaries, which
// meant a very long Tuesday for everyone. All per-user offsets are applied
// downstream in the formatter, never here. If exports look off by hours,
// check the formatter first. The pinned build token is on the next line.

build token for kagaf-hahof: htk14_9d3d4d26d7d8de

Plugin authors must verify their extensions against the new shared connection pooler before release sign-off. Pools are now capped per plugin namespace, and idle connections are reclaimed after ninety seconds rather than being held indefinitely. Plugins that open raw connections outside the pool will be rejected at load time. Run the bundled compatibility harness, confirm zero leaked-handle warnings, and attach the report to your submission. The reference build used for harness validation carries the token below.

trace token, kaduf-kadup: htk14_d0223cc3c18e70